HORROR-BLY YOURS, THE EC GHOULUNATICS


EC Comics is the unequivocal touchstone for horror comics in popular culture and their influence is incalculable. With the publication of CREEPY, Jame Warren revitalized the tradition, even hiring some of the artists from the EC bullpen.

Publisher William Gaines was not averse to making his titles fan-friendly by including lively letters pages and a club whose members were called "EC Fan-Addicts". In 1951, photos were made available of the comics' horror hosts, collectively known as The GhouLunatics. The person posing in all three shots is none other than Johnny Craig with makeup chores accomplished by Al Feldstein. Enough revenue was received to send one of Gaines' office boys to college!

Above is pictured a 3-piece set of rare busts that were commissioned by Bill Gaines but never put into production. This is the only known set of busts with a dark brown glaze. Another was cast in off-white. Each stood from 9" to 10" tall with a 1.75" wood base and an engraved nameplate.
